LIC Stock Analysis: 12-17% Potential Upside in 3-4 Weeks

Unlocking Potential: Axis Securities Bullish on LIC Stock with 12-17% Upside

Axis Securities recently shared some positive insights about Life Insurance Corporation of India (LIC) stock. According to them, LIC stock has broken through a significant resistance level at Rs 754, suggesting a positive trend. The brokerage recommends buying LIC within the range of Rs 790-774, with a target price of Rs 874-916. This implies a potential upside of 12-17% over the next 3-4 weeks.

The technical analysis from Axis Securities indicates a strong breakout with increased trading volume, indicating active market participation. The current price stands at Rs 801.20, showing a slight decline of 1.73% at 9.36 am.

Axis Securities highlights positive indicators, such as the bullish trajectory of the weekly and daily Relative Strength Index (RSI), suggesting a favorable market bias. RSI is a tool used in technical analysis to assess a security’s recent price changes and identify overvalued or undervalued conditions.

The previous performance of LIC stock also reveals a bullish reversal pattern called an Inverted Head & Shoulder, observed at Rs 680 on the weekly chart in late November 2023. This pattern implies a potential upward trend in the stock’s price.

Recent developments in the insurance sector, particularly a draft note from the Insurance Regulatory and Development Authority of India (IRDAI) proposing changes in surrender value calculations for non-linked insurance products, have impacted insurance stocks. Analysts mention potential negative effects on life insurance companies’ Value of New Business (VNB) margins due to proposed caps on surrender penalties.

Kotak Institutional Equities emphasizes the need for clarity on specific ratios for calculating surrender values. Nomura India suggests that if accepted, the proposal may lead life insurance companies to adjust their portfolios for profitability, affecting product design, pricing, and viability for non-linked products.

Unlocking Gains: SAIL, J&K Bank, HAL Trading Tips

Unlocking Potential Gains: Trading Strategies for SAIL, J&K Bank, and Hindustan Aeronautics

In the dynamic world of stock trading, keeping an eye on buzzing stocks can be the key to unlocking potential gains. As we navigate the ups and downs of the market, three stocks have recently caught the attention of traders and investors alike: Steel Authority of India Ltd (SAIL), Jammu & Kashmir Bank Ltd (J&K Bank), and Hindustan Aeronautic Ltd. Let’s delve into the trading strategies shared by Avdhut Bagkar, a seasoned Derivatives & Technical Analyst at StoxBox, to make sense of the market movements.

SAIL: Riding the Upside Wave
Suggested Action: Buy
Target Price: Rs 120-135 | Stop Loss: Rs 100

Steel Authority of India Ltd, commonly known as SAIL, has been on a positive trajectory with a fresh upside, backed by robust volumes in the short term. The stock, having recently achieved a new 52-week high, is poised to ascend to levels between Rs 120 and Rs 135. According to technical analysis, the positive bias remains intact unless there’s a significant dip below Rs 100. Despite being in the overbought category, as indicated by the Relative Strength Index (RSI), the momentum remains strong, signaling continued support for the bulls.

J&K Bank: Conquering Hurdles with Confidence
Suggested Action: Hold
Target Price: Rs 160 | Stop Loss: Rs 120

Jammu & Kashmir Bank Ltd (J&K Bank) has exhibited resilience by surpassing the Rs 120 hurdle with aggressive volumes. This achievement signals a positive bias, with the price action anticipated to reach the Rs 160-170 range. The 50-simple moving average (SMA) provides additional support, bolstering the stock’s potential for further rally. A breakout pattern, identified as an ‘Ascending Triangle’ on the weekly chart, adds to the optimism surrounding J&K Bank.

Hindustan Aeronautics: Navigating Uncharted Territory
Suggested Action: Range-bound
Resistance: Rs 3,200 | Support: Rs 2,400

Hindustan Aeronautics, a key player in the aerospace industry, is deemed to be range-bound with a positive outlook. Investors are advised to consider any weakness in the stock as an opportunity for accumulation. The immediate support levels are pegged at Rs 2,600 and Rs 2,400, with the stock aiming for uncharted territory at Rs 3,200. This suggests a broader optimistic outlook for Hindustan Aeronautics shares.

Sensex Soars: Record Highs with 955 Points Gain

Record-Breaking Surge: Indian Stock Market Hits All-Time Highs with Sensex Up by 955 Points

In today’s trading, the stock market in India reached a new all-time high. The BSE Sensex, which includes 30 major stocks, went up by 955 points, reaching a record of 70,540. The broader NSE Nifty index also increased by 263 points, hitting a new high of 21,189.55.

Not only the major stocks but also smaller and mid-sized ones saw positive movements. The Nifty Midcap 100 rose by 0.84%, and small-cap stocks gained 1.13%. The India VIX, an index indicating market fear, went up by 3.23% to 12.46.

This surge is attributed to the rise in shares of IT companies, which make a significant portion of their revenue from the US. This comes after the Federal Reserve mentioned progress in easing inflation while keeping interest rates steady.

In the global market, Asian markets mostly showed positive trends, and Wall Street equities gained in the previous session.

Foreign portfolio investors (FPIs) bought Indian shares worth Rs 4,710.86 crore, while domestic institutional investors (DIIs) sold shares worth Rs 958.49 crore.

Among the 15 sector gauges compiled by the NSE, 12 were trading positively. Sectors like IT, Banking, and Financial Services outperformed, while Pharma, Healthcare, and Media sectors faced declines.

On a stock-specific note, Tech Mahindra led the gains in the Nifty pack, rising by 3.73%. Other gainers included HCL Tech, LTIMindtree, Wipro, and Bajaj Finance.

However, some stocks, such as PowerGrid, BPCL, Cipla, Nestle India, and Sun Pharma, faced declines.

The market breadth was positive, with 2,199 shares advancing and 765 declining on BSE. Notable gainers on the BSE index included HDFC Bank, ICICI Bank, Infy, Reliance Industries, Tata Consultancy Services, Axis Bank, and Bajaj Finance.

Additionally, Sonata Software, Mastek, Adani Total Gas, Mphasis, HUDCO, Adani Green, Manappuram Finance, and Zensar Technologies saw significant surges, while Chambal Fertilisers, Hindustan Zinc, Nippon Life India Asset Management, and Vedant Fashions faced declines, falling up to 2%.

Hyderabad Real Estate Market Booms in October 2023

Hyderabad’s Residential Real Estate Market Witnesses Robust Growth in October 2023

The Hyderabad residential real estate market exhibited a remarkable surge in growth during October 2023, with a 25% year-on-year (YoY) increase in property registrations. This upward trend is indicative of a growing appetite for residential properties in Hyderabad, driven by a combination of factors such as improved infrastructure, economic growth, and a burgeoning IT industry.

Key Highlights of October 2023 Residential Property Registrations

  • Total property registrations: 5,787
  • YoY increase: 25%
  • The total value of properties registered: Rs. 3,170 crore
  • YoY increase: 41%

Price Segmentation and Size Preferences

The price range of Rs. 25 lakh to Rs. 50 lakh accounted for the highest proportion of property registrations, capturing 50% of the market share. This indicates a continued demand for affordable housing options in Hyderabad. However, there was also a notable increase in demand for higher-value properties, with properties priced above Rs. 1 crore witnessing a 2% rise in registrations compared to October 2022.

In terms of size preferences, properties in the 1,000-2,000 sq ft range dominated the market, accounting for 69% of registrations. While there was a slight moderation in demand for smaller homes (500-1,000 sq ft), properties larger than 2,000 sq ft saw an increase in demand.

District-Level Analysis

Medchal-Malkajgiri maintained its position as the leading district for home sales registrations, accounting for 43% of the total. Rangareddy district followed closely with 42% of sales registrations, while Hyderabad district accounted for 14%.

Price Trends

The weighted average prices of transacted residential properties witnessed a YoY increase of 6.8% in October 2023. Among the districts, Hyderabad, Medchal-Malkajgiri, and Rangareddy all experienced a 6% increase in property prices respectively.

Factors Driving Growth

The robust growth of Hyderabad’s residential real estate market can be attributed to several factors:

  • Improved infrastructure: The development of new roads, metro rail, and other infrastructure projects has enhanced connectivity and accessibility within the city, making it more attractive for potential homeowners.
  • Economic growth: Hyderabad’s strong economic growth, driven by the IT and ITeS sectors, has created employment opportunities and boosted the purchasing power of residents.
  • Burgeoning IT industry: The presence of numerous IT and ITeS companies in Hyderabad has attracted a large workforce, fueling demand for residential properties.
